Aging

Come take a walk with me
Before my life has passed.
There are beautiful things to see and do,
So we must not walk too fast.
Come walk along with me;
We will share so many things.
There are paths that need exploring,
Where our spirits can soar on wings.
The beauty of life is precious,
A gift to be cherished each day.
So as you stroll along with me,
Enjoy the treasures along the way.
If you come and walk with me
Through the pages of my mind,
We will take away nothing but memories - -
And leave only footprints behind.

Everyone wants to live long but no one wants to get old.

"Good days are to be gathered like sunshine in grapes, to be trodden and bottled into wine and kept for age to sip at ease beside the fire. If the traveler has vintaged well, he need trouble to wander no longer; the ruby moments glow in his glass at will." Writer Freya Stark

"Grow old along with me! . . . The best is yet to be, the last of life for which the first was made. Our times are in His hand." from the poem "Rabbi Ben Ezra" by Robert Browning

"Growing old - it's not nice, but it's interesting." Playwright August Strindberg

"I am delighted to find that even at my age great ideas come to me, the pursuit and development of which should require another lifetime." Writer Johann Wolfgang von Goethe

"I'm just the same age I've always been." Writer Carolyn Wells

"In youth we learn; in age we understand." Ebner - Eschenbach

"It is really something of a feat to have lived seventy-five years, in spite of illnesses, germs, accidents, disasters, and wars. And now every fresh day finds me more filled with wonder and better qualified to draw the last drop of delight from it." Writer Maurice Goudeket

"Men are like wine, some turn to vinegar, but the best improve with age." Pope John XXIII

"Old age is like everything else. To make a success of it, you've got to start young." Fred Astaire

"Remember your Creator in the days of your youth, before the days of trouble come and the years approach when you will say, "'I find no pleasure in them' -" Ecclesiastes 12:1

"The best is yet to be, the last of life for which the first was made. Our times are in His hand." from the poem "Rabbi Ben Ezra" by Robert Browning

"The great thing about getting older is that you don't lose all the other ages you've been." Writer Madeleine L'Engle

"There are dreams of love, life, and adventure in all of us. But we are also sadly filled with reasons why we shouldn't try. These reasons seem to protect us, but in truth they imprison us. They hold life at a distance. Life will be over sooner than we think. If we have bikes to ride and people to love, now is the time." Elisabeth Kubler-Ross

"Things are more like they are now than they ever were before." Former U.S. President Dwight D. Eisenhower

"When I was young, I admired clever people. Now that I am old, I admire thoughtful people." Abraham Joshua Heschel

"When you are younger you get blamed for crimes you never committed qnd when you're older you begin to get credit for virtues you never possessed. It evens itself out." George Santayana

"What is life? It is the flash of a firefly in the night. It is the breath of a buffalo in the wintertime. It is the little shadow which runs across the grass and loses itself in the sunset." Last words of Blackfoot warrior Crowfoot

You can't stop yourself from getting old, but you can always be immature.
